Carol Cecilia Bown Sepúlveda (born 30 September 1978) is a Chilean lawyer who was elected as a member of the Chilean Constitutional Convention.[1][2][3][4][5]
During part of the second government of Sebastián Piñera (2018−2022), she was Undersecretary for Childhood,[6][7][8][9][10][11] institution linked to the Social Development Minister.
